On 13-09-21, 10:00, Rafał Miłecki wrote:
From: Rafał Miłecki <rafal@milecki.pl> The old binding was covering the whole DMU block space (DMU block contains CRU block which contains USB PHY). It was a bad design, overkill and a non-generic solution. Northstar's USB 2.0 PHY is a small block (part of the CRU MFD) and binding should be designed to represent that properly. Rework the binding to map just PHY with the "reg" property and use syscon to reference shared register that controls block access. The old binding is deprecated now.
